The present invention provides a process comprising substitution of an acceptor molecule comprising a group -XC(O)- wherein X is O, S or NR 8 , where R 8 is C 1-6 alkyl, C 6-12 aryl or hydrogen, with a nucleophile, wherein the acceptor molecule is cyclised such that the said nucleophilic substitution at -XC(O)- occurs without racemisation. This process has particular application for the production of a peptide by extension from the activated carboxy-terminus of an acyl amino acid residue without epimerisation. |
